Common NameNiazirin
ClassSmall Molecule
DescriptionConstituent of the leaves of the horseradish tree (Moringa oleifera, Moringaceae). Niazirin is found in brassicas.

Chemical Taxonomy
Description belongs to the class of organic compounds known as phenolic glycosides. These are organic compounds containing a phenolic structure attached to a glycosyl moiety. Some examples of phenolic structures include lignans, and flavonoids. Among the sugar units found in natural glycosides are D-glucose, L-Fructose, and L rhamnose.
